Mensaf (Jordanian Lamb Stew)

Submitted by: Nova 
Living In: Minneapolis, Minnesota, USA
Mensaf, the traditional national dish of Jordan, layers pita bread and rice with stewed lamb chunks in a goat's milk sauce. Spices, onions, garlic, and butter can also be added to season the sauce. You can choose whether to eat mensaf the traditional Jordanian way, standing up and rolling the rice into balls with your hands, or use a fork.
